Erin Watson

Guest Experience Specialist - Bowers School Farm

Erin has been a volunteer in the Bloomfield Hills Schools community since 2011 and first experienced Bowers Farm as a parent chaperone for her daughter’s 2nd grade class.  Since that day, it’s held a special place in her heart as she watched her children find such joy learning about the animals on the farm.

She holds a Master of Social Work from Wayne State University, with a focus on Community, Policy, and Leadership and has worked in a variety of fields including foster care, senior community housing, nonprofit management, and event planning.   She continues to be an active volunteer with Friends of the Johnson Nature Center and the BHS PTO Council.

Erin is a hobbyist gardener who strives to find balance between design and function with the goal to feed her family of 6 with easily accessible and nutritious fruits and veggies.  

Her passion includes community engagement, ecological conservation, and finding wellness through the restorative power of understanding and connecting with our natural world.  

She is excited at the opportunity to foster fun and meaningful experiences around healthy food systems in our community, as part of the Bowers team!
